From 938a287d3ef9d21c40efb5a2cacbf71a5c2a306e Mon Sep 17 00:00:00 2001 From: Tim Ledbetter Date: Wed, 27 Sep 2023 06:11:47 +0100 Subject: [PATCH] ls: Left justify owner and group information in long format --- Userland/Utilities/ls.cpp |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/Userland/Utilities/ls.cpp b/Userland/Utilities/ls.cpp index 505b2b2187..25df323360 100644 --- a/Userland/Utilities/ls.cpp +++ b/Userland/Utilities/ls.cpp @@ -373,18 +373,18 @@ static bool print_filesystem_object(DeprecatedString const& path, DeprecatedStri if (!flag_hide_owner) { auto username = users.get(st.st_uid); if (!flag_print_numeric && username.has_value()) { - printf(" %7s", username.value().characters()); + printf(" %-7s", username.value().characters()); } else { - printf(" %7u", st.st_uid); + printf(" %-7u", st.st_uid); } } if (!flag_hide_group) { auto groupname = groups.get(st.st_gid); if (!flag_print_numeric && groupname.has_value()) { - printf(" %7s", groupname.value().characters()); + printf(" %-7s", groupname.value().characters()); } else { - printf(" %7u", st.st_gid); + printf(" %-7u", st.st_gid); } }